What does the amino acid glutamate do?

What does the amino acid glutamate do?

Glutamate is one of the most abundant of the amino acids. In addition to its role in protein structure, it plays critical roles in nutrition, metabolism and signaling. Post-translational carboxylation of glutamyl residues increases their affinity for calcium and plays a major role in hemostasis.

How does glutamine become glutamate?

The glutamine is taken into the presynaptic terminals and metabolized into glutamate by the phosphate-activated glutaminase (a mitochondrial enzyme). Once the vesicle is released, glutamate is removed from the synaptic cleft by excitatory amino-acid transporters (EAATs).

What part of the brain produces glutamate?

Glutamate is synthesized in the central nervous system from glutamine as part of the glutamate–glutamine cycle by the enzyme glutaminase. This can occur in the presynaptic neuron or in neighboring glial cells.

What disorders are associated with glutamate?

Having too much glutamate in the brain has been associated with neurological diseases such as Parkinson’s disease, multiple sclerosis, Alzheimer’s disease, stroke, and ALS (amyotrophic lateral sclerosis or Lou Gehrig’s disease).
